Haldyn Glass Ltd has been upgraded from a Hold to a Buy rating following a comprehensive reassessment of its quality, valuation, financial trends, and technical indicators. The company’s robust quarterly results, improved debt metrics, and a shift to bullish technical trends have collectively driven this positive revision, signalling renewed investor confidence in this micro-cap packaging stock.

Quality Assessment: Financial Strength and Operational Efficiency

Haldyn Glass’s quality rating has improved significantly, supported by its very positive financial performance in Q4 FY25-26. The company reported a remarkable 63.72% growth in net profit for the quarter ended March 2026, marking its second consecutive quarter of positive results. This consistent profitability underscores operational resilience in a competitive packaging sector.

Key financial ratios highlight the company’s strong ability to service debt, with a Debt to EBITDA ratio of just 1.85 times, indicating manageable leverage. The operating profit to interest coverage ratio stands at a robust 5.29 times, reflecting ample earnings to cover interest expenses. Additionally, the debt-equity ratio is notably low at 0.49 times as of the half-year mark, further emphasising a conservative capital structure.

Efficiency metrics such as the debtors turnover ratio have also improved, reaching 6.36 times, signalling effective receivables management and cash flow generation. Return on Capital Employed (ROCE) is attractive at 9.5%, demonstrating efficient utilisation of capital to generate profits. These factors collectively enhance the company’s quality grade, reinforcing its Buy recommendation.

Valuation: Attractive Pricing Relative to Peers

Haldyn Glass’s valuation has become increasingly compelling. The stock currently trades at ₹114.30, well below its 52-week high of ₹154.65, offering a margin of safety for investors. Its Enterprise Value to Capital Employed ratio is a modest 2.1, suggesting the stock is undervalued compared to its historical averages and peer group.

Over the past year, the company’s profits have surged by 39.1%, while the stock price has appreciated by 12.11%. This disparity results in a PEG ratio of 0.6, indicating the stock is undervalued relative to its earnings growth potential. Such valuation metrics support the upgrade from Hold to Buy, signalling that the stock offers attractive upside potential at current levels.

Financial Trend: Sustained Profit Growth and Market Outperformance

The financial trend for Haldyn Glass has been decidedly positive, with the company delivering strong quarterly results and consistent profit growth. The 63.72% increase in net profit for Q4 FY25-26 is a standout figure, complemented by a 39.1% rise in profits over the past year. This growth trajectory is supported by prudent financial management and operational improvements.

In terms of market performance, Haldyn Glass has outperformed key benchmarks over multiple time horizons. Year-to-date, the stock has returned 17.38%, compared to a negative 13.72% for the Sensex. Over one year, the stock gained 12.11%, while the Sensex declined by 10.54%. Longer-term returns are even more impressive, with a 3-year return of 58.46% versus 16.99% for the Sensex, and a 10-year return of 308.21% compared to 172.10% for the benchmark index.

These figures highlight the company’s ability to generate market-beating returns, reinforcing the positive financial trend and justifying the upgrade to a Buy rating.

Technicals: Shift to Bullish Momentum

The most significant catalyst for the rating upgrade was the marked improvement in technical indicators. The technical trend for Haldyn Glass has shifted from sideways to bullish, signalling renewed investor interest and momentum.

Key technical signals include a bullish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) on the weekly chart and a mildly bullish MACD on the monthly chart. Bollinger Bands are bullish on both weekly and monthly timeframes, indicating upward price momentum and volatility expansion. Daily moving averages have also turned bullish, supporting short-term strength.

Other indicators such as the Know Sure Thing (KST) oscillator show a bullish weekly reading, although the monthly KST remains bearish, suggesting some caution over longer horizons. The Dow Theory is mildly bearish on the weekly chart but shows no clear trend monthly. On-Balance Volume (OBV) is bullish monthly but neutral weekly, indicating accumulation over the medium term.

Price action today reflects this technical optimism, with the stock rising 4.81% to ₹114.30, hitting a high of ₹116.00 and a low of ₹109.45. This price movement confirms the bullish technical setup and supports the upgrade decision.

Risks and Considerations

Despite the positive outlook, investors should be mindful of certain risks. Haldyn Glass remains a micro-cap stock, which inherently carries higher volatility and liquidity risks compared to larger companies. Notably, domestic mutual funds hold a negligible stake in the company, currently at 0%. Given that mutual funds typically conduct thorough on-the-ground research, their limited exposure may indicate reservations about the stock’s price or business fundamentals.

Investors should also consider the broader packaging industry dynamics and potential macroeconomic headwinds that could impact demand and margins. While the company’s financial and technical indicators are currently favourable, market conditions can change rapidly, warranting ongoing monitoring.

Conclusion: A Convincing Upgrade to Buy

Haldyn Glass Ltd’s upgrade from Hold to Buy is well justified by a combination of strong financial results, attractive valuation metrics, sustained profit growth, and a clear shift to bullish technical trends. The company’s ability to service debt comfortably, alongside market-beating returns over multiple timeframes, enhances its investment appeal.

While risks remain, particularly given its micro-cap status and limited institutional ownership, the overall picture is positive. Investors seeking exposure to the packaging sector with a focus on quality and growth may find Haldyn Glass an appealing addition to their portfolios at current levels.
